Step 1
Preheat oven to 350 degrees. Line an 8-inch pan with parchment paper or line with foil and grease the foil very well. In a large bowl, stir together the butter and sugar until smooth.
Step 2
Add the egg and vanilla and stir to combine. Stir in the flour and salt, just until combined. Stir in the coconut and pecans. Add chocolate chips, if desired.
Step 3
Scoop the batter into the prepared pan and spread to the sides. Bake 25-28 minutes, until an inserted toothpick has moist crumbs. The blondies should be slightly browned along the edges.
Step 4
Cool in the pan for at least 20 minutes and then lift the brownies out by the foil/paper and set on wire rack to finish cooling before slicing and storing in an airtight container. Enjoy!
